Sam: the only data I have to offer is that the L245 was tested at Nebraska U. in 1978 and delivered 22.09 max PTO HP and 17.83 max drawbar HP. Kubota's 3-digit L models denoted claimed flywheel HP. The L245 is 24.5 HP. My L275 is 27.5 HP. I don't think this holds true anymore with newer model number designations although I've sort of lost touch with what Kubota is doing lately other than quickly escalating beyond anything I can afford.
